Building efficient animation blending systems that preserve intent across complex locomotion states.
This evergreen guide explores robust techniques for blending character animations across intricate locomotion graphs, ensuring smooth transitions, consistent goals, and scalable performance in modern game engines and interactive simulations.
Published July 30, 2025
Facebook X Reddit Pinterest Email
As game worlds grow more ambitious, the challenge of seamlessly blending locomotion states becomes increasingly central. Designers define diverse movement modes—walking, running, jumping, climbing, and idling—each with distinct timing, arc, and pose considerations. The practical payoff of an effective blending system is the preservation of intent: the character should appear to accelerate naturally, recover balance after a stomp, and maintain expressive timing during changes in gait. Engineers tackle this by decomposing motion into signals that can be smoothly interpolated, layered, and blended without collapsing into abrupt or artificial motion. The result is a more believable avatar that responds gracefully to user input and environmental cues alike.
A well-structured approach begins with a clear state machine that maps locomotion intents to animation clips. Yet the real power lies in how transitions are weighted and timed. Designers implement blend trees or graph-based evaluators to modulate influence between clips in response to velocity, direction, and surface characteristics. Crucially, blending must respect physical plausibility: torque limits, center of mass shifts, and leg reach all constrain how transitions unfold. By recording intent alongside motion data, the system can infer how a change should feel rather than simply how it should look. This alignment between purpose and presentation underpins authentic, readable character motion in diverse scenarios.
Subline 2: 9–11 words to frame guard rails and constraints.
The core strategy for preserving intent during blends is to separate content from timing while maintaining synchronization cues. Motion content—the pose history, contact states, and energy curves—remains fixed, while timing adapts to new inputs. This decoupling allows the engine to adjust speed, acceleration, and cadence without distorting the fundamental motion goals. By enforcing a shared reference for all animated limbs, the system reduces drift and jitter when transitioning between distant states. A well-tuned blend then becomes a choreography where timing, momentum, and contact consistency align with the actor’s intended purpose.
ADVERTISEMENT
ADVERTISEMENT
Engineers implement robust guard rails that prevent perceptual artifacts during transitions. These guards often include soft constraints on joint angles, momentum preservation, and root motion consistency. The blend controller monitors a blend parameter, velocity, and surface context to decide when to initiate or finish a transition. If environmental factors demand a quicker change, the system can temporarily exaggerate a pose or stretch timing in a controlled manner, returning to normal as soon as feasible. This approach balances responsiveness with believability, ensuring that rapid input does not override physical plausibility.
Subline 3: 9–11 words to emphasize hierarchy and priority in blends.
Layering animation data is another powerful technique for preserving intent across locomotion states. Instead of relying on a single clip to cover all behavior, developers build modular animation layers: core movement, high-frequency adjustments, and expressive tweaks. Each layer contributes a distinct dimension to motion, and the blend algorithm composes them in real time. For example, a core walk cycle might remain steady while a separate head or hand layer adds subtle sway or anticipatory motions. The layering approach reduces the risk of overfitting a single transition to a narrow context, making the system more adaptable to new terrains or gameplay demands.
ADVERTISEMENT
ADVERTISEMENT
A practical challenge arises when multiple locomotion goals collide, such as running while crouching or sliding into a cover pose. To address this, designers employ hierarchical blending where higher-priority motions influence the outcome more heavily. This ensures essential intents—like avoiding a collision or maintaining balance—take precedence over secondary effects. The blending engine can also push certain parameters toward neutral during complex maneuvers to avoid conflicting cues. The result is a smoother, more coherent motion profile across situations that push the character beyond normal gait patterns, without sacrificing readability.
Subline 4: 9–11 words to highlight performance optimizations and data management.
Beyond core systems, accurate contact modeling is critical for believable locomotion. Contact states describe when a foot is in the air versus planted, which affects ground reaction forces and pose transitions. By tying blend updates to contact events, the engine preserves timing fidelity and reduces foot-skid or slide artifacts. In practice, the solver uses cached contact histories to anticipate upcoming steps, smoothing transitions across irregular terrains. This attention to ground truth ensures that even complex actions—like traversing stairs or uneven surfaces—adhere to a physically plausible rhythm, reinforcing the player’s sense of immersion.
Performance considerations shape the design of efficient animation blending. Real-time games demand low-latency updates, often at high frame rates, with a limited budget for CPU and GPU time dedicated to animation. Developers optimize by pruning unnecessary states, caching frequently used blends, and streaming animation data only when needed. They also leverage parallelism, running the blend calculations on dedicated threads or vectorized units to avoid stalling the main game loop. The art lies in achieving smooth, consistent motion without introducing jitter, latency, or memory pressure that could degrade the gameplay experience.
ADVERTISEMENT
ADVERTISEMENT
Subline 5: 9–11 words to underscore validation and iteration cycles.
A practical workflow for building a robust blending system starts with thorough data curation. Artists supply a coherent catalog of locomotion clips with consistent timing, pose references, and root motion traits. Technical direction then aligns these assets with a flexible blending schema, ensuring that each clip can participate in a broad set of transitions. Prototyping tools let engineers experiment with different blend curves, thresholds, and priorities before committing to a production-ready pipeline. Clear documentation and shared conventions accelerate collaboration between animators, designers, and programmers, reducing misinterpretations that could undermine motion consistency.
Finally, validation should extend beyond visual inspection to quantitative measures. Engineers define metrics for blend smoothness, transition duration, energy consistency, and pose error during cross-fades. Automated tests simulate thousands of inputs, including edge cases like abrupt directional changes or sneaking at low speeds. The results guide refinements to timing heuristics and weight functions, helping the team converge on a stable, predictable system. Informed by data, the blending architecture evolves to accommodate new locomotion idioms without regressing established intent.
In the long run, modularity is key to future-proofing animation blends. As new locomotion concepts arise—climbing, crawling, or dynamic dodges—the framework should absorb them with minimal disruption. A well-designed blend graph supports hot-swapping of clips, parameterized curves, and context-aware overrides, enabling rapid experimentation. Engineers should be mindful of cross-platform consistency, ensuring that behavior remains coherent on PC, console, and mobile hardware alike. This forward-looking stance, paired with a disciplined development workflow, yields a resilient system capable of preserving intent across evolving gameplay demands.
The heart of an effective animation blending system lies in disciplined integration of data, physics, and artistry. When purpose, timing, and spatial coherence align, transitions feel inevitable rather than engineered. Teams that invest in robust state machines, layered architecture, and pragmatic validation cultivate motion that resonates with players. The payoff is not merely polish; it is reliability under pressure—whether a hero lunges into cover, a creature pivots to face a threat, or a vehicle negotiates a downhill turn. With careful design, animation blending becomes a silent collaborator that enhances storytelling through motion.
Related Articles
Game development
This evergreen guide explores designing physics-based character controllers that adapt fluidly to diverse surfaces, slopes, steps, and barriers, ensuring believable movement, stability, and player immersion across platforms and game genres.
-
July 21, 2025
Game development
A practical, evergreen guide that explores crafting onboarding tutorials for games, emphasizing teaching core systems without stripping player choice, ensuring fluid learning curves, and sustaining long-term engagement through meaningful experimentation.
-
August 08, 2025
Game development
This evergreen guide outlines disciplined experimentation in games, balancing robust methods, clear hypotheses, measurable outcomes, and ethical safeguards to protect players while uncovering durable retention improvements.
-
July 23, 2025
Game development
A practical guide to constructing deterministic asset validation suites that guarantee consistent runtime behavior across diverse configurations, builds, and optimization levels for modern game engines.
-
July 31, 2025
Game development
Designing resilient analytics dashboards empowers non technical stakeholders to craft quick ad hoc insights, tailor visualizations, and set real time alerts, reducing dependency on developers and speeding decision cycles.
-
July 18, 2025
Game development
In modern game ecosystems, identity systems must protect player privacy while enabling flexible aliases, consent-driven data sharing, and reliable cross-platform linking, all supported by robust threat modeling, verifiable audits, and scalable privacy controls.
-
July 19, 2025
Game development
As gameplay studios scale, a shared analytics ontology becomes indispensable for consistent data collection, faster insights, and cross-team collaboration, enabling reliable comparisons while preserving project-specific nuance and creativity.
-
July 21, 2025
Game development
Achieving trustworthy game progress requires robust integrity controls, consistent cross-platform state management, tamper resistance, and scalable data synchronization strategies that work seamlessly across diverse devices and environments.
-
August 03, 2025
Game development
A practical, evergreen guide explains asset dependency versioning, its role in collaborative game development, and how teams can implement robust strategies to prevent resource incompatibilities and streamline asset management.
-
July 28, 2025
Game development
Achieving smooth visual transitions with adaptive level-of-detail blending requires thoughtful curve design, real-time evaluation, and performance-aware decisions that minimize artifacts while preserving detail and responsiveness in dynamic scenes.
-
August 08, 2025
Game development
This evergreen guide examines modular UI compositors for game HUDs, detailing reusable widgets, disciplined layout strategies, interaction contracts, and scalable patterns that stay maintainable across evolving UI needs.
-
July 30, 2025
Game development
This evergreen guide explores scalable techniques for expressive player emotes, creative animation blending, and network-aware optimizations that keep large congregations lively without compromising performance or bandwidth.
-
July 18, 2025
Game development
Designing balanced AI matchmakers ensures engaging play, reduces frustration, and sustains long-term player retention through skill-appropriate bot opponents and humane behavior modeling across diverse player styles.
-
July 26, 2025
Game development
Modern game architectures benefit from robust dependency injection strategies that decouple core systems, improve testability, and enable flexible module composition across platforms, engines, and gameplay scenarios.
-
July 19, 2025
Game development
Comprehensive asset provenance logging strengthens licensing audits, attribution accuracy, and third-party compliance by documenting origins, licenses, usage contexts, and change history across all game assets throughout development lifecycles.
-
July 19, 2025
Game development
This article examines practical approaches to deterministic networking for games, detailing principled strategies that harmonize lockstep rigidity with responsive client-side prediction, while preserving fairness, reproducibility, and maintainable codebases across platforms and teams.
-
July 16, 2025
Game development
This article explains a resilient approach to asset hot-swapping during live events, detailing architecture, workflows, and safeguards that let games deploy limited-time content without forcing client updates or disrupting players.
-
July 23, 2025
Game development
A practical guide for crafting believable, self-regulating NPC ecosystems in games, where hunger, reproduction, and territorial dynamics interact to produce dynamic worlds, emergent narratives, and richer player experiences.
-
July 21, 2025
Game development
In modern game backends, resilience hinges on thoughtfully engineered failover and replication patterns that keep services available, data consistent, and players immersed, even when components fail or network partitions occur.
-
August 03, 2025
Game development
A comprehensive guide to designing robust telemetry pipelines that securely collect data, anonymize sensitive elements, and deliver timely, actionable insights to both designers and engineers for informed decision making.
-
July 14, 2025